The "Let's Dance" candidates have been chosen. In addition to Jan Hofer and Senna Gammour, Barack Obama's half-sister will also compete.

The "Let's Dance" floor will open on February 26 at 8:15 pm. 14 celebrities are fighting for the title "Dancing Star 2021" in the 14th season of the RTL program. The broadcaster has now announced which candidates will take on the challenge. Also present: the former "Tagesschau" spokesman Jan Hofer (68) and the former Monrose singer Senna Gammour (41). From the musical front, ex- "DSDS" participant Vanessa Neigert (28), singer Ilse DeLange (43) and party hit star Mickie Krause (50, "One week awake") will join them.

Barack Obama's half-sister dances with us

Auma Obama (60) brings a big name into play. She is a sociologist and German studies specialist as well as the older half-sister of the former US President Barack Obama (59). Her athletic competitors include professional boxer Simon Zachenhuber (22) and soccer star Rúrik Gíslason (32). "Formula 1" presenter Kai Ebel (56) is also part of the party.

No "Let's Dance" season without TV stars. This is where actress Valentina Pahde (26), Erol Sander (52, "Soraya") and the first "Prince Charming", Nicolas Puschmann (29), come into play. The latter will walk on the dance floor in the arms of a man. Who else is fighting for the title successor to Lili Paul-Roncallis (22)? Presenter Lola Weippert (24) and model Kim Riekenberg (26).
